Управление рисками при переходе от Discovery к Delivery

Пройдите тест, узнайте какой профессии подходите

Я предпочитаю
0%
Работать самостоятельно и не зависеть от других
Работать в команде и рассчитывать на помощь коллег
Организовывать и контролировать процесс работы

Введение в процессы Discovery и Delivery

Процессы Discovery и Delivery играют ключевую роль в разработке продуктов и услуг. Discovery — это этап, на котором команда исследует проблему, определяет потребности пользователей и формирует гипотезы. Delivery — это этап, на котором команда реализует решения, проверяет гипотезы и доставляет продукт пользователям. Переход от Discovery к Delivery часто сопровождается рисками, которые могут существенно повлиять на успех проекта. Понимание этих процессов и умение управлять рисками на каждом из них является важным навыком для любой команды.

Кинга Идем в IT: пошаговый план для смены профессии

Что такое Discovery?

Discovery — это начальный этап разработки продукта, на котором команда сосредотачивается на исследовании и понимании проблемы, которую необходимо решить. В этот период проводятся различные исследования, включая интервью с пользователями, анализ рынка и конкурентного окружения, а также сбор и анализ данных. Основная цель Discovery — сформировать четкое понимание потребностей пользователей и определить, какие решения могут быть наиболее эффективными.

Что такое Delivery?

Delivery — это этап, на котором команда приступает к реализации решений, разработанных на этапе Discovery. Здесь происходит разработка, тестирование и внедрение продукта. Основная цель Delivery — доставить пользователям готовый продукт, который решает их проблемы и удовлетворяет их потребности. Важно отметить, что успешный переход от Discovery к Delivery требует тщательного планирования и управления рисками.

Идентификация и оценка рисков на этапе Discovery

На этапе Discovery важно не только выявить потребности пользователей, но и оценить потенциальные риски, которые могут возникнуть при переходе к Delivery. Основные риски включают:

  • Неправильное понимание потребностей пользователей: Если команда неправильно интерпретирует данные, это может привести к разработке ненужных функций. Например, если команда проводит недостаточное количество интервью с пользователями или неправильно анализирует полученные данные, это может привести к созданию продукта, который не решает реальные проблемы пользователей.
  • Недостаточное тестирование гипотез: Недостаточное внимание к проверке гипотез может привести к ошибкам на этапе Delivery. Если гипотезы не проверены должным образом, команда может потратить много времени и ресурсов на разработку функций, которые не будут востребованы пользователями.
  • Ограниченные ресурсы: Недостаток времени, бюджета или кадров может стать серьезным препятствием. Например, если команда не имеет достаточного количества специалистов или времени для проведения всех необходимых исследований, это может привести к недостаточной проработке продукта на этапе Discovery.

Для оценки рисков можно использовать матрицу рисков, которая позволяет классифицировать риски по вероятности их возникновения и потенциальному влиянию на проект. Это помогает команде сосредоточиться на наиболее критических рисках и разработать стратегии для их минимизации.

Методы оценки рисков

Существует несколько методов оценки рисков, которые могут быть полезны на этапе Discovery:

  • SWOT-анализ: Этот метод позволяет оценить сильные и слабые стороны проекта, а также выявить возможности и угрозы.
  • Анализ сценариев: Этот метод включает разработку различных сценариев развития событий и оценку их влияния на проект.
  • Анализ чувствительности: Этот метод позволяет оценить, как изменения в различных параметрах проекта могут повлиять на его успех.

Стратегии управления рисками при переходе к Delivery

Чтобы минимизировать риски при переходе от Discovery к Delivery, можно использовать следующие стратегии:

  • Постоянная коммуникация: Регулярные встречи и обсуждения между командами Discovery и Delivery помогут избежать недопонимания и обеспечат согласованность действий. Важно, чтобы все участники проекта были в курсе текущего состояния дел и могли оперативно реагировать на возникающие проблемы.
  • Итеративный подход: Разделение проекта на небольшие итерации позволяет быстрее выявлять и устранять проблемы. Это также позволяет команде более гибко реагировать на изменения и адаптироваться к новым условиям.
  • Прототипирование и тестирование: Создание прототипов и их тестирование на ранних этапах помогает выявить потенциальные проблемы до начала разработки. Это позволяет команде внести необходимые изменения и улучшения до того, как продукт будет готов к выпуску.
  • Гибкое планирование: Использование гибких методологий, таких как Scrum или Kanban, позволяет адаптироваться к изменениям и быстро реагировать на возникающие риски. Эти методологии предполагают регулярные встречи, ретроспективы и планирование, что помогает команде оставаться на правильном пути и своевременно выявлять и устранять проблемы.

Дополнительные стратегии

Кроме основных стратегий, существуют и другие методы управления рисками, которые могут быть полезны:

  • Резервирование ресурсов: Создание резервов времени, бюджета и кадров позволяет команде быть готовой к неожиданным ситуациям и быстро реагировать на изменения.
  • Анализ рисков и планирование мер по их снижению: Регулярный анализ рисков и разработка планов по их снижению помогает команде быть готовой к различным ситуациям и минимизировать их влияние на проект.
  • Обучение и развитие команды: Постоянное обучение и развитие команды помогает улучшить ее навыки и знания, что позволяет более эффективно управлять рисками и решать возникающие проблемы.

Инструменты и методы для минимизации рисков

Существует множество инструментов и методов, которые помогают минимизировать риски при переходе от Discovery к Delivery:

  • JIRA: Этот инструмент помогает управлять задачами и отслеживать прогресс проекта. JIRA позволяет создавать задачи, назначать их исполнителям, отслеживать их выполнение и вести учет времени. Это помогает команде быть в курсе текущего состояния дел и своевременно реагировать на возникающие проблемы.
  • Trello: Простой и удобный инструмент для управления проектами и задачами. Trello позволяет создавать доски, списки и карточки, что помогает визуализировать процесс работы и отслеживать прогресс. Это также позволяет команде быть в курсе текущего состояния дел и своевременно реагировать на возникающие проблемы.
  • Miro: Онлайн-доска для совместной работы, которая позволяет визуализировать идеи и процессы. Miro позволяет создавать диаграммы, карты мыслей, прототипы и другие визуальные материалы, что помогает команде лучше понимать и обсуждать проект.
  • UserTesting: Платформа для проведения пользовательских тестов и получения обратной связи. UserTesting позволяет проводить тестирование продукта на реальных пользователях, что помогает выявить проблемы и улучшить продукт до его выпуска.
  • Lean Canvas: Шаблон для быстрого описания бизнес-модели, который помогает выявить ключевые риски и предположения. Lean Canvas позволяет команде быстро оценить и описать основные аспекты проекта, что помогает сосредоточиться на наиболее критических рисках и принять обоснованные решения.

Дополнительные инструменты

Кроме перечисленных инструментов, существуют и другие, которые могут быть полезны для управления рисками:

  • Asana: Инструмент для управления проектами и задачами, который позволяет отслеживать прогресс и координировать работу команды.
  • Slack: Платформа для командной коммуникации, которая позволяет обмениваться сообщениями, файлами и вести обсуждения в реальном времени.
  • Google Analytics: Инструмент для анализа данных и отслеживания поведения пользователей, который помогает выявить проблемы и улучшить продукт.

Примеры успешного управления рисками на практике

Пример 1: Компания X

Компания X решила разработать новое мобильное приложение. На этапе Discovery команда провела серию интервью с пользователями и выявила основные потребности. Для минимизации рисков они создали несколько прототипов и протестировали их на целевой аудитории. Это позволило им выявить слабые места и внести необходимые изменения до начала разработки. В результате, на этапе Delivery команда смогла избежать серьезных проблем и успешно запустить продукт.

Пример 2: Компания Y

Компания Y столкнулась с проблемой недостатка ресурсов на этапе Discovery. Чтобы минимизировать риски, они приняли решение использовать гибкую методологию Scrum. Это позволило им эффективно распределить ресурсы и адаптироваться к изменениям. Регулярные встречи и ретроспективы помогли команде выявлять и устранять проблемы на ранних этапах, что значительно снизило риски при переходе к Delivery.

Пример 3: Компания Z

Компания Z работала над сложным проектом с множеством неизвестных. Для минимизации рисков они использовали Lean Canvas, чтобы быстро описать и оценить ключевые предположения и риски. Это позволило им сосредоточиться на наиболее критических аспектах проекта и принять обоснованные решения. В результате, они смогли успешно перейти от Discovery к Delivery и запустить продукт в срок.

Дополнительные примеры

Пример 4: Компания A

Компания A разработала новый SaaS-продукт. На этапе Discovery они провели обширное исследование рынка и конкурентов, что позволило им выявить ключевые потребности пользователей. Для минимизации рисков они использовали прототипирование и тестирование, что помогло им выявить и устранить проблемы до начала разработки. В результате, на этапе Delivery команда смогла успешно запустить продукт и получить положительные отзывы от пользователей.

Пример 5: Компания B

Компания B работала над проектом с ограниченным бюджетом. Чтобы минимизировать риски, они приняли решение использовать Kanban-методологию. Это позволило им эффективно управлять задачами и ресурсами, а также быстро реагировать на изменения. Регулярные встречи и обсуждения помогли команде выявлять и устранять проблемы на ранних этапах, что значительно снизило риски при переходе к Delivery.

Эти примеры показывают, что правильное управление рисками на этапе перехода от Discovery к Delivery играет ключевую роль в успехе проекта. Использование различных стратегий, инструментов и методов помогает минимизировать риски и обеспечить успешную реализацию продукта.

Читайте также